コード例 #1
0
        protected void Page_Load(object sender, EventArgs e)
        {
            try
            {
                if (!IsPostBack)
                {
                    var id        = Convert.ToInt32(Request.QueryString["id"]);
                    var objEntity = new TafsirLib.Teacher().Get(id);

                    butDelete.Visible  = objEntity.Id > 0;
                    txtid.Value        = objEntity.Id.ToString();
                    txtfname.Value     = objEntity.FirstName;
                    txtlname.Value     = objEntity.LastName;
                    txtuname.Value     = objEntity.UserName;
                    txtemail.Value     = objEntity.Email;
                    txttel.Value       = objEntity.Tel;
                    txtrezom.InnerText = objEntity.Rezome;
                    isActivate.Value   = Convert.ToInt32(objEntity.Active) == 1 ? "1" : "2";
                    gred.Value         = objEntity.Grade;
                }
            }
            catch (Exception)
            {
                //var err = ex.Message;
            }
        }
コード例 #2
0
ファイル: Course.aspx.cs プロジェクト: AliRahimian110/8tafsir
        protected void Page_Load(object sender, EventArgs e)
        {
            try
            {
                //if (!IsPostBack)
                //{
                //    txtTeacher.DataTextField = "LastName";
                //    txtTeacher.DataValueField = "Id";
                //    txtTeacher.DataSource = new TafsirLib.Teacher().ListFullName();
                //    txtTeacher.DataBind();
                //}
            }
            catch (Exception ex)
            {
                var t = ex.Message;
            }

            try
            {
                if (!IsPostBack)
                {
                    var id        = Convert.ToInt32(Request.QueryString["id"]);
                    var objEntity = new TafsirLib.Course().Get(id);

                    //butDelete.Visible = objEntity.Id > 0;

                    //txtID.Value = objEntity.Id;
                    txtNumberCourse.InnerText = objEntity.NumberCourse;
                    txtVAHED.InnerText        = objEntity.Vahed.ToString();
                    txtTitle.InnerText        = objEntity.Title;
                    txtDateStart.InnerText    = objEntity.DateStart;
                    txtTimeCourse.InnerText   = objEntity.TimeCourse;
                    txtTimeQuiz.InnerText     = objEntity.TimeQuiz;
                    txtLength.InnerText       = objEntity.Length;
                    txtAddress.InnerText      = objEntity.Address;
                    txtDescription.InnerText  = objEntity.Description;
                    //txtLink.Value = objEntity.Link;
                    //txtActive.Checked = objEntity.Active;


                    txtTypeCourse.InnerText = objEntity.TypeCourse == 1 ? "حضوری" : "غیر حضوری";

                    var tea = new TafsirLib.Teacher().Get(objEntity.TeacherId);
                    txtTeacher.InnerText = tea.FirstName + ' ' + tea.LastName;
                }
            }
            catch (Exception ex)
            {
                //
            }
        }
コード例 #3
0
        protected void butDelete_OnClick(object sender, EventArgs e)
        {
            try
            {
                var id  = Convert.ToInt32(Request.QueryString["id"]);
                var ret = new TafsirLib.Teacher().Delete(id);

                if (ret > 0)
                {
                    //Response.Redirect("TeacherList.aspx");
                    Page.ClientScript.RegisterStartupScript(GetType(), "msgbox", "alert('اطلاعات مورد نظر شما حذف شد');window.location.href = 'TeacherList.aspx';", true);
                }
                else
                {
                    Page.ClientScript.RegisterStartupScript(GetType(), "msgbox", "alert('خطا در حذف اطلاعات');", true);
                }
            }
            catch (Exception ex)
            {
            }
        }